what does your boost gauge read??

hi all,

 

My boost gauge sits between the small marking (10.5 psi?) and the last 14psi marking, so about 12.5psi or so.

 

its an unmodified (as far as i know!) uk manual.

 

I know the stock gauge can be very inaccurate, just wondered what everyone elses reads (as standard tongue.gif)
